OMAP baseline test results for v3.9-rc1 Here are some basic OMAP test results for Linux v3.9-rc1. Logs and other details at: http://www.pwsan.com/omap/testlogs/test_v3.9-rc1/20130312100243/ Test summary ------------ Build: FAIL ( 4/16): am33xx_only, omap1_defconfig, omap1_defconfig_5912osk_only, omap2plus_defconfig_2430sdp_only Pass (12/16): n800_multi_omap2xxx, n800_only_a, omap1_defconfig_1510innovator_only, omap2plus_defconfig, omap2plus_defconfig_cpupm, omap2plus_defconfig_no_pm, omap2plus_defconfig_omap2_4_only, omap2plus_defconfig_omap3_4_only, rmk_omap3430_ldp_allnoconfig, rmk_omap3430_ldp_oldconfig, rmk_omap4430_sdp_allnoconfig rmk_omap4430_sdp_oldconfig Boot to userspace: FAIL ( 5/11): 2430sdp, 37xxevm, 5912osk, am335xbone, cmt3517 Pass ( 6/11): 2420n800, 3517evm, 3530es3beagle, 3730beaglexm, 4430es2panda, 4460pandaes PM ret, suspend: FAIL ( 4/ 6): 2430sdp, 37xxevm, 4430es2panda, 4460pandaes Pass ( 2/ 6): 3530es3beagle, 3730beaglexm PM ret, dynamic idle: FAIL ( 4/ 6): 2430sdp, 37xxevm, 4430es2panda, 4460pandaes Pass ( 2/ 6): 3530es3beagle, 3730beaglexm PM off, suspend: FAIL ( 3/ 5): 37xxevm, 4430es2panda, 4460pandaes Pass ( 2/ 5): 3530es3beagle, 3730beaglexm PM off, dynamic idle: FAIL ( 3/ 5): 37xxevm, 4430es2panda, 4460pandaes Pass ( 2/ 5): 3530es3beagle, 3730beaglexm Failing tests: fixed by posted patches -------------------------------------- Build: * omap1_defconfig: several problems with mach-omap1/board-h2.c - Fixed by Tony: http://www.spinics.net/lists/arm-kernel/msg224133.html * omap1_defconfig_5912osk_only: implicit declaration of function 'cpu_is_omap15xx' - Fixed by Aaro: http://www.spinics.net/lists/linux-omap/msg87523.html PM: * 4460pandaes: chip not entering retention in dynamic idle - Presumably 4430es2panda also fails this - Caused by 17b7e7d33530e2bbd3bdc90f4db09b91cfdde2bb (ARM: OMAP4: clock/hwmod data: start to remove some IP block control "clocks") - Fixed by "ARM: OMAP4: PM: fix PM regression introduced by recent clock cleanup" - http://www.spinics.net/lists/arm-kernel/msg224419.html Failing tests: needing investigation ------------------------------------ Build: * am33xx_only, omap2plus_defconfig_2430sdp_only: omap-{smp,hotplug}.c link errors Boot tests: * 2430sdp & 37xxevm: hang during MMC partition probe - Cause unknown * 3517EVM & CM-T3517: boot hangs with NFS root - Likely some Kconfig, board file, and PM issues with EMAC - Longstanding bug * CM-T3517: boot hangs with MMC root - Due to missing MMC setup in board file - http://www.spinics.net/lists/arm-kernel/msg211471.html - Longstanding bug - Should be fixed by Igor Grinberg's "ARM: OMAP3: cm-t3517: add MMC support" - Retesting due to testbed error; was inadvertently NFS-booting CM-T3517 Boot warnings: * CM-T3517: L3 in-band error with IPSS during boot - Cause unknown but see http://marc.info/?l=linux-omap&m=134833869730129&w=2 - Longstanding issue; does not occur on the 3517EVM PM tests: * 2430sdp: pwrdm state mismatch(dsp_pwrdm) 0 != 3 - need to doublecheck wakeup dependencies - (am assuming it's still there; does not boot to userspace) * 2430sdp: power domains not entering retention - Cause unknown - (am assuming it's still there; does not boot to userspace) * 4430es2panda, 4460pandaes: pwrdm state mismatch on CAM, DSS, ABE * 4460pandaes: pwrdm state mismatch on IVAHD, TESLA * 4430es2panda: CORE, TESLA, IVAHD, L3INIT didn't enter target state - Probably due to lack of reset code for M3, DSP, SL2IF, FSUSB per discussion with Tero Kristo - Likely dependent on the bootloader version - fails with 2012.07-00136-g755de79 * 4460pandaes: CORE, L3INIT didn't enter target state - Cause unknown; appeared with v3.9-rc1 * 3730 Beagle XM: does not serial wake from off-idle suspend when console UART doesn't clock-gate ("debug ignore_loglevel") - Cause unknown - Not yet part of the automated test suite - Re-tested at v3.7; still failing: http://www.pwsan.com/omap/transcripts/20121211-3730beaglexm-3.7-pm-offmode-fail-debug.txt Other: * 4430es2panda: omap_hwmod: l3_instr: _wait_target_disable failed - Unknown cause; could be due to the lack of hierarchical enable/disable in hwmod code - Jon Hunter reports this does not appear with the same X-loader/bootloader on his 4430ES2.3 Panda, so could be ES-level dependent ------------------------------------------------------------------------------ Branch: test_v3.9-rc1 Test-Serial: 20130312100243 Commit-ID: 6dbe51c251a327e012439c4772097a13df43c5b8 Test-Target-Board-Count: 11
